S.F. No. 513 - Law Enforcement Memorial Plates
 
Author: Senator David H. Senjem
 
Prepared By: Alexis C. Stangl, Senate Counsel (651/296-4397)
 
Date: February 13, 2017



 

S.F. No. 513 requires the commissioner of transportation to issue special law enforcement memorial license plates.

Subdivision 1. [Issuance of plates.] The commissioner must issue plates to an applicant who is the registered owner of a vehicle, pays the registration tax and other fees, and complies with the laws governing registration of motor vehicles and licensing of drivers. An applicant must pay an additional $10 for each set of plates. The applicant must make an initial contribution of $25, and a $5 minimum annual contribution thereafter, to the Minnesota Law Enforcement Memorial Association.

Subdivision 2 [Design.] The commissioner must adopt a design that represents the thin blue line.

Subdivision 3. [Plates transfer.] The plates may be transferred to another vehicle owned by the person to whom the plates were issued.

Subdivision 4. [Exemption.]  Submission of a request to the commissioner to issue the plates is not required. 

Subdivision 5. [Fees.]  Fees collected under this Act, except the donation to the Minnesota Law Enforcement Memorial Association, are credited to the vehicle services operating account in the special revenue fund.

This Act is effective on January 1, 2018.
